Transaction 8212b61f678baa3cd314428ec45e13950195c5a30de8a90cd69efec58f9bf7ca
1 Input
1 Output
-
8212b61f678baa3cd314428ec45e13950195c5a30de8a90cd69efec58f9bf7ca:0
- value
- 6429890
- script pubkey
- OP_0 OP_PUSHBYTES_20 01ae0a2b5db74efb17fe280df9de7370c899364d
- address
- ltc1qqxhq526aka80k9l79qxlnhnnwryfjdjdwfjpg3